Fog Computing vs. Edge Computing: Unterschied und Vergleich

Das Internet der Dinge oder IoT hat uns vollständig umgeben, und Fog Computing und Edge Computing sind ein Teil davon. Diese beiden mildern die Latenzzeit; Beide teilen jedoch einige Sicherheits- und Datenschutzprobleme.

Edge Computing funktioniert nicht mit der Cloud, und hier gewinnt Fog Computing, da es kompetent in der Arbeit mit der Cloud ist.

Key Take Away

  1. Fog-Computing verteilt Rechenressourcen über ein Netzwerk und verbessert die Datenverarbeitung näher an der Quelle, während Edge-Computing Daten an der Peripherie des Netzwerks oder in der Nähe des Datenerzeugungsgeräts verarbeitet.
  2. Fog Computing deckt einen breiteren Bereich ab und bedient mehrere Edge-Geräte und Benutzer, während Edge Computing sich auf einzelne Geräte konzentriert.
  3. Fog-Computing ermöglicht eine bessere Skalierbarkeit und verarbeitet mehr Daten als Edge-Computing.

Nebel-Computing vs. Edge-Computing

Fog Computing ist eine dezentrale Computerinfrastruktur, die Daten zwischen der Datenquelle und der Cloud produziert. Sie findet weiter entfernt von den Sensoren statt, die die Daten erzeugen. Edge Computing ist ein verteiltes Computerparadigma, das Daten näher an ihrem Entstehungsort verarbeitet.

Nebel-Computing vs. Edge-Computing

Fog Computing kann als Erweiterung des Cloud Computing interpretiert werden. Es entscheidet, ob ein Datensatz über eine Cloud oder persönliche Ressourcen bereitgestellt wird.

Es konzentriert sich mehr auf die Infrastrukturebene. Fog Computing bestätigt, dass cyber-physische Systeme ihre Aufgaben gut erfüllen.

Edge Computing kann als ein Architekt definiert werden, der im IoT benötigt wird. Die Datenkommunikation mit Edge-Computing-Geräten ist sehr einfach.

Lesen Sie auch:  Struktur vs. Union in C: Unterschied und Vergleich

Für den Aufbau von Edge Computing kann man nicht auf bereits vorhandene Systemelemente zurückgreifen. Stattdessen werden neue Komponenten benötigt. Es konzentriert sich auf die Ebene der Dinge im IoT.

Vergleichstabelle

VergleichsparameterNebelberechnung Edge Computing
DatenprozessFog Computing entscheidet, ob Daten über eine Cloud oder persönliche Ressourcen gesendet werden.Edge Computing verarbeitet Daten manuell, anstatt sie an die Cloud zu senden.
CloudEs ist in der Lage, mit der Cloud zu arbeiten. Mit der Cloud funktioniert es nicht. 
Umgang mit mehreren IoT-AnwendungenEs unterstützt die Handhabung mehrerer IoT-Anwendungen.Der Umgang mit mehreren IoT-Anwendungen wird nicht unterstützt.
Setzen Sie mit Achtsamkeit Der Fokus liegt auf der Infrastrukturebene. Sein Fokus liegt auf der Ebene der Dinge.
Ausbildung Es kann aus bereits bestehenden Systemelementen adaptiert werden. Dies muss als neues System aufgebaut werden.  
Pinne dies jetzt, um dich später daran zu erinnern
Das anpinnen

Was ist Fog-Computing?

Fog Computing kann als Erweiterung des Cloud Computing definiert werden. Es erstreckt sich vom Kern des Netzwerks bis zum Rand des Netzwerks.

Cisco hat diesen Begriff erfunden. Es ist eine Zwischenschicht. 

Es wird von der Cloud-Schicht vergrößert und bringt die Computernetzwerke auf diese Weise näher an Speichergeräte heran. Dadurch rücken auch die Endknoten im IoT näher zusammen. 

Die Geräte, die sich am Edge befinden, sind unter dem Namen Nebelknoten bekannt. Diese können überall mit Netzwerkkonnektivität bereitgestellt werden.

Es wird in Gleisanlagen, Verkehrsleitstellen, Parkuhren etc. eingesetzt. Fog Computing sollte nicht als Alternative zum Cloud Computing betrachtet werden; vielmehr ist es als erweiterte Form des Cloud Computing zu sehen.

Lesen Sie auch:  Domainname vs. URL: Unterschied und Vergleich

Die Verzögerung beim Senden von Daten an die Cloud wird mit Hilfe von Fog Computing verringert. Auch die Sicherheitsprobleme, die bei der Übertragung von Daten in die Cloud auftreten, werden von Fog Computing gelöst.

Wir können also sagen, dass die Gesamtsystemeffizienz durch Fog Computing aufrechterhalten und verbessert wird. Am Ende stellt Fog Computing sicher, dass die Operationen unter kritischen cyber-physischen Systemen verstärkt werden und den Anforderungen entsprechen.

Was ist Edge Computing?

Edge Computing kann als Architekt definiert werden. Diese Architektur verwendet Endbenutzer-Clients.

Es ist auch bekannt, ein oder mehrere benutzernahe Randgeräte zu verwenden. Edge Computing arbeitet zusammen und schiebt dann Recheneinrichtungen auf mehrere Datenquellen zu.

Diese Ressourcen sind Sensoren, Mobilgeräte und andere.

Edge Computing kann die Qualität der Leistung des Gesamtsystems erweitern. Edge Computing kann nicht mit Hilfe bestehender Komponenten erfolgen.

Es erfordert ein neues System, um geformt zu werden. Wenn es um die Datenkommunikation geht, ist Edge Computing sehr einfach.

Wir können zweifellos sagen, dass es einfacher ist als Fog Computing. 

Edge Computing hat auch geringere Chancen zu scheitern. Die Intelligenz und Leistungsfähigkeit des Edge-Gateways wird durch Edge Computing platziert und in verschiedene Geräte, z. B. programmierbare Automatisierungssteuerungen, integriert.

Datenschutzprobleme sind jedoch ein Problem in Bezug auf Edge Computing. 

Im Fall der drahtlosen Netzwerksicherheit hat es keinen sehr anständigen Schutz zu bieten. Der Authentifizierung kann ebenfalls nicht vertraut werden.  

Edge-Computing

Hauptunterschiede zwischen Fog Computing und Edge Computing

  1. Fog Computing ist verantwortlich für die Entscheidung über den Modus der Datenübermittlung. Dies kann über eine Cloud oder sogar persönliche Ressourcen erfolgen, während Edge Computing Daten direkt manuell verarbeitet. Es wartet nicht auf die Wolke.
  2. Fog Computing kann problemlos mit der Cloud arbeiten, aber Edge Computing kann nicht mit der Cloud funktionieren.
  3. Fog Computing kann mehrere IoT-Anwendungen unterstützen und handhaben, während Edge Computing andererseits nicht in der Lage ist, mehrere IoT-Anwendungen zu unterstützen.
  4. Fog Computing konzentriert sich auf die Infrastrukturebene, Edge Computing hingegen konzentriert sich voll und ganz auf die Ebene der Dinge.
  5. Fog Computing kann aus bereits bestehenden Systemelementen adaptiert werden, Edge Computing muss jedoch als ganz neues System aufgebaut werden. Es ist wie ein Mini-Cloud-Rechenzentrum. 
  6. Fog Computing wird möglicherweise nicht von Netzbetreibern kontrolliert, aber Edge Computing ermöglicht es Mobilfunknetzbetreibern, bestehende Dienste zu verbessern.
  7. Fog Computing besteht aus einer hierarchischen und flachen Architektur, die mehrere Schichten besitzt, und diese Schichten sind für den Aufbau eines Netzwerks verantwortlich. Auf der anderen Seite enthält Edge Computing mehrere Knoten, die kein Netzwerk bilden können. 
Literaturhinweise
  1. https://ieeexplore.ieee.org/abstract/document/8016213/
  2. https://www.sciencedirect.com/science/article/pii/S1383762118306349

Möchten Sie diesen Artikel für später speichern? Klicken Sie auf das Herz in der unteren rechten Ecke, um in Ihrer eigenen Artikelbox zu speichern!

Über den Autor

Chara Yadav hat einen MBA in Finanzen. Ihr Ziel ist es, finanzbezogene Themen zu vereinfachen. Sie ist seit rund 25 Jahren im Finanzbereich tätig. Sie hat mehrere Finanz- und Bankkurse für Business Schools und Gemeinden gehalten. Lesen Sie mehr bei ihr Bio-Seite.